At present we curently have a problem in our clan with comms,we have sorted a short list out of place names and commands to keep chatter to a minimum,but the guys just don't seem to get the nack of things.

In matches it ends up going pear shaped because team mates are throwing nades etc and blowing up our own squad.
Does anyone have some good comms exercises that will be good for a multinational clan,or a mod they use to increase comms effectiveness?

Any help would be great.

make the name represent something in the area. For example on Strike by the fountaion u have those baskets. DO NOT say "he is over by the fountain", DO say "1 on Baskets" make it short and easily "translated". Many times you will see some1 in a spot you do not know what to call. Example a person up on the glitch roof above garage on stirek. DO NOT say "By A" DO SAY "Roof Above Garage" . other than that practice practice practice

I think mainly the trouble is with ideas to learn place names,we already mapped out place names over a period of time and distributed the maps.
I found a good mod that may be useful and fun at the same time in training called the 'hide and seek mod',with this instead of a carachter you choose your class and your carachter displays as that class,the classes are things like tree,lamp post,bike,box etc.
One person hiding and the rest seeking,this way hopefully the person hiding can give clues to where they are on the map,enabling peope to remember the names better,and allow them to find the person hiding.
When we mapped out the place names we did exactly like you said,for instance on hotel,statue,tyre shop,red stripe etc,visual clues.
This doesn't seem to be the problem,it's more getting people to talk,it's only a handful but we're having to leave them out of games,and get players of lower quality who do use comms.

Practice, practice and more practice. That's what we found. Nothing else helps more.

Name the places as simple as possible i.e. easy to remember and then practice on the public server, friendly scrims and during matches. Eventually it will sit.

We do name checks during training so that we all are reminded what places are called, especially on maps we do not play a lot and it is great to see it/hear it working during a match when someone says "one A bins, one double palms" (Strike) and watch the change in your teams focus. :D
